Earthshock

The Century Dictionary and Cyclopedia
  • noun. An earthquake; specifically, the most violent oscillations curing the continuance of an earthquake; also, the sudden movement of the ground consequent upon the intentional explosion of a mine or the accidental explosion of a magazine of explosives.
